Zoning Board Denies Rezoning

January 12, 2016 By Dick Cook 0 Comments

On Monday night, the East Ridge Zoning Appeals Board denied a request to rezone property for the construction of two duplexes. The property on Worsham Avenue, a dead-end street in the 600 block of Marlboro Avenue, has a drainage ditch that dissects the two lots measuring 162 feet by 142 feet. Water Line Break Hinders Traffic

January 6, 2016 By Dick Cook 0 Comments

A broken water line on Ringgold Road posed a problem to motorists Wednesday morning.
